PENGARUH PENGEMBANGAN KARIR TERHADAP KINERJA PEGAWAI DI KANTOR PELAYANAN KEKAYAAN NEGARA DAN LELANG (KPKNL) KOTA MAKASSAR

This study purposed to find out the effect of career development on employee performance at the Makassar City State Property and Auction Service Office (KPKNL). This study used a quantitative approach. The processed data resulted from the distribution of the instrument in the form of a questionnaire to 54 samples. This study used a saturated sampling technique. The results of the descriptive analysis research showed that the Career Development variable (X) based on indicators of educational background, training, work experience were categorized well with an average score of 59.20% and Employee Performance variable (Y) based on quantity, quality, completion time, cooperation, categorized as good enough with an average score of 57.48%. Based on the results of a simple regression test, it was proved that career development has a positive and significant effect on employee performance at the Makassar City State Property and Auction Service Office (KPKNL). This was concluded, the higher the career development, the employee's performance could increase.
